Introduction
Cultural expertise plays a crucial role in resolving conflicts and claiming rights in diverse societies. This interdisciplinary field combines theoretical insights with practical case studies to provide a comprehensive understanding of the complexities involved in cultural interactions. By examining the cultural perspectives of individuals and groups, cultural expertise helps to identify and address the underlying causes of conflicts, promote dialogue and understanding, and facilitate the peaceful resolution of disputes.

Theory and Practice
Cultural expertise encompasses a wide range of theoretical frameworks and methodologies. It draws from disciplines such as anthropology, sociology, psychology, and political science to analyze the cultural dimensions of conflict and rights claims. The theoretical framework provides a foundation for understanding the cultural norms, values, and beliefs that shape individuals and groups' behavior and interactions.

Case Studies
To illustrate the practical application of cultural expertise, case studies are used extensively. These case studies provide real-world examples of conflicts and rights claims that have been resolved through cultural understanding and sensitivity. By analyzing these case studies, students gain a deeper understanding of the cultural factors that contribute to conflict and the strategies that can be used to address them.

Interdisciplinary Exploration
Cultural expertise is an interdisciplinary field that draws on the expertise of professionals from various fields. This interdisciplinary approach ensures that a comprehensive understanding of the topic is achieved. It allows for the integration of different perspectives and the exploration of the complex relationships between culture, conflict, and rights.

Conclusion
Cultural expertise is a vital tool for resolving conflicts and claiming rights in diverse societies. By combining theory and case studies, interdisciplinary exploration, and a cultural understanding, cultural expertise helps to promote dialogue, understanding, and peace. It is essential for individuals and organizations working in conflict resolution and human rights to have a comprehensive understanding of the cultural dimensions of these issues.
